NM “Négociant Manipulant” A producer who buys all or some of his grapes from other growers. Anything at all under 94% estate fruit should be labeled NM. Maison Champagne is labeled with this producer course, but it surely’s not fully unusual to determine grower Champagne less than this classification in addition.

A Récoltant-Manipulant, independently helps make his / her wines onsite below her or his personal label working with grapes grown on the home's vineyards completely (Rainon and his spouse drop below this definition). Wines from these producers are colloquially often called "grower Champagnes" and make up a really smaller percentage of the international market place.
